What are the main differences between safflower and brotwurst?

  • Safflower is richer in copper, manganese, magnesium, vitamin B6, vitamin B5, vitamin B1, phosphorus, and iron, yet brotwurst is richer in vitamin B12.
  • Safflower's daily need coverage for copper is 185% higher.
  • Safflower has 67 times more vitamin B5 than brotwurst. Safflower has 4.03mg of vitamin B5, while brotwurst has 0.06mg.
  • Safflower contains less sodium.

We used Seeds, safflower seed kernels, dried and Brotwurst, pork, beef, link types in this comparison.
